2. Navigate to SEMrush Traffic Analytics

Head to the official SEMrush Traffic Analytics page. Here, you'll find a detailed overview of your website's traffic metrics, including visits, unique visitors, average visit duration, and bounce rate.

3. Analyze Competitive Traffic

Use SEMrush to compare your website traffic with competitors. Tools like 'Traffic Journey' and 'Audience Insights' highlight where your competitors' traffic is coming from and how it engages with their content. This step is crucial for identifying strengths and gaps in your strategy.

4. Examine Traffic Sources

Traffic source analysis helps you understand how visitors find your website. SEMrush categorizes traffic into Direct, Referral, Search, Social, and Paid. Each category indicates different user acquisition methods, helping you refine your marketing tactics.

5. Leverage Audience Insights

Understanding your audience is key to tailoring your content and marketing efforts. SEMrush provides detailed demographic information, such as age, gender, and interests, enabling you to create targeted campaigns.

6. Monitor Mobile vs. Desktop Traffic

As mobile browsing continues to rise, it's vital to monitor the distribution of traffic between mobile and desktop users. SEMrush offers insights into this distribution, helping you optimize your website for better user experience across devices.

Insights and Common Mistakes to Avoid

Insights:

  • Continuous Monitoring: Regular traffic analysis helps you stay updated with trends and fluctuations.
  • Holistic View: Consider all traffic sources and audience segments to form a well-rounded strategy.
  • Competitor Benchmarking: Regularly compare your metrics with competitors to spot opportunities for improvement.

Common Mistakes:

  • Ignoring Smaller Traffic Sources: Even small volume traffic from niche sites can be highly valuable.
  • Over-Reliance on a Single Data Point: Use multiple metrics to understand the broader picture.
  • Lack of Actionable Steps: Ensure your analysis translates into concrete actions to improve your website performance.
